Mobile video services specialist Dilithium has launched a fresh assault on the European market.

The US firm is one of the leading companies in the circuit-switched video business – using 3G video calling as the means to deliver various mobile content services. It has just completed a European ‘tour’ of operators, content providers and press to shine a spotlight on its four core technologies:

·    Video blogging: enabling mobile users to record, review, upload and share personal videos
·    Video streaming: letting consumers use 3G video calling to view video content, such as sports clips and music videos via a video call
·    Video ringbacks: delivering personalised videos to play when a video call is made between 3G users
·    Live VideoTV: an alternative means to viewing a TV broadcast

·    Participation TV: enabling viewers direct video interactions with TV programmes

The company is hoping to replicate its success in the Far East, where it has already launched its VT-Ring video ringback platform and found consumers far more receptive to the idea of making video calls than elsewhere.

Mitch Lewis, senior VP of Dilithium's service providers business unit, told ME: “3G calling is such a seamless and intuitive way to deliver entertaining video services, but there’s certainly work to be done educating the industry and the public about the channel. Having said that, we have 80 deployments already live so we’re very confident about the future.”

Dilithium’s existing customers in Europe include D2See, Echovox and Materna.
